sqlite3 delete if exists SQLite3是一个轻量级的数据库系统,常用于嵌入式系统和移动应用。它支持SQL语言,包括DELETE语句,用于删除表中的记录。 如果您想在SQLite3中使用DELETE语句删除记录,并且只在记录存在时进行删除,您可以使用"IF EXISTS"子句。这个子句可以避免因尝试删除不存在的记录而引发的错误。 下面是一个...
=err{fmt.Println(err)}stmt,_:=database.Prepare("create table if not exists user(id integer primary key, firstname text, lastname text)")stmt.Exec()stmt,_=database.Prepare("insert into user( firstname, lastname) values(?,?)")stmt.Exec("Jack","Chen")varid intvarfirstname stringvarla...
publicclassMainActivityextendsAppCompatActivity{privateDBHelperdbHelper;@OverrideprotectedvoidonCreate(BundlesavedInstanceState){super.onCreate(savedInstanceState);setContentView(R.layout.activity_main);// 初始化数据库帮助类dbHelper=newDBHelper(this);// 删除表deleteTable();}privatevoiddeleteTable(){SQLite...
cu.execute(“delete from catalog where id= 1″) cx.commit() cu.execute(“select * from catalog”) cu.fetchall() 输出 代码语言:javascript 代码运行次数:0 运行 AI代码解释 [(0, 0, 'name2')] 连接对象方法: commit 方法总是可用的,但如果数据库不支持事务,它就没有任何作用。如果关闭了连接但...
user_updates列,显示由INSERT、UPDATE和DELETE操作引起的更新的数量。如果这个数字相对于读的数量很高,考虑删除这个索引: DROP INDEX IX_TITLE ON dbo.Book 1. 锁 如果数据库有很多查询在同时执行,一些查询会访问相同的资源,例如一张表或索引。在一个查询更新资源时,另一个查询是不能读的;否则会导致不一致的结果...
}// 删除数据voidDeleteData(sqlite3* db,intid){constchar* deleteDataSQL ="DELETE FROM Users WHERE Id=?;"; sqlite3_stmt* statement;if(sqlite3_prepare_v2(db, deleteDataSQL,-1, &statement,nullptr) == SQLITE_OK) {// 绑定参数sqlite3_bind_int(statement,1, id);// 执行语句if(sqlite3_step...
SQLite DELETE 语句的语法: DELETE FROM table_name WHERE {CONDITION}; SQLite DETACH DATABASE 语句的语法: DETACH DATABASE 'Alias-Name'; SQLite DISTINCT 语句的语法: SELECT DISTINCT column1, column2...columnN FROM table_name; SQLite DROP INDEX 语句的语法: DROP...
原型:delete from 表名 where 条件; 例子:delete from kk where online == 0; 修改 原型:update 表名 set 列=值,列=值 where 条件; 原型:update kk set name = "ikun",online = 1 where name == "ggb"; 七、sqlite使用实例(教学管理数据库) ...
DELETE FROM table_name WHERE condition; table_name是要删除数据的表的名称。 condition是可选项,用于指定删除数据的条件。 例如,从 "students" 表中删除 id 为 1 的数据: DELETE FROM students WHERE id = 1; (4)更新数据 要更新SQLite数据库表中的数据,可以使用UPDATE语句。语法如下: ...
btn_deleteTable.setOnClickListener(this); btn_newTable.setOnClickListener(this); myOpenHelper = new MySQLiteOpenHelper(this);// 实例一个数据库辅助器 //备注1 ---如果你使用的是将数据库的文件创建在SD卡中,那么创建数据库mysql如下操作: // if (!path.exists()) {// 目录存在返回false // path...